Slim, boyishly handsome Peter Makarewicz, 16, of Norwood, begins a life sentence in state prison today for the sex strangling of his school chum and neighbor, Geraldine Annese, 15.
Joseph Annese, 63, father of the slain girl, who lived only a block from the Makarewicz home, commented grimly:
“The verdict was okay. But I would feel better if he got death like my daughter.”
